Springfield, IL — Robin Roberts Stadium is proud to welcome Rob O’Neill, former Navy SEAL and best known as the man who fired the shots that killed Osama bin Laden, as the keynote speaker for the first-ever “Heroes at Home Plate” event on Saturday, May 2, 2026.

The evening begins at 6:30 PM, with doors opening at 5:30 PM.

“Heroes at Home Plate” is a new speaker series designed to bring inspiring individuals from all walks of life to Springfield—people who have shown courage, leadership, and impact through their stories and experiences. Rob O’Neill’s journey from small-town Montana to one of the most elite units in the world, with over 400 combat missions, offers a powerful perspective on decision-making under pressure, resilience, and what it means to lead.

About Rob O’Neill:
Rob O’Neill is a former Navy SEAL Team operator with a distinguished career spanning 17 years. He participated in some of the most high-profile missions in U.S. military history and has since become a bestselling author, speaker, and podcast host. Through his storytelling, he offers insights into leadership, risk-taking, and perseverance under extreme conditions.
